Your Opportunity:


In keeping with Alberta Health Services Mission Statement and Values, and as an integral member of the Environmental Services Team, the Working Lead is responsible for routine cleaning, collection of general waste and upkeep of the facility as well as all detailed or special cleanings in areas such as operating rooms, pharmacy, etc.

The Working Lead must perform audits, maintain schedules, and communicate with ES1 employees. Must follow Infection Prevention and Control (IPC) standards.

The Working Lead daily routines and approaches at work are to produce a clean, safe, comfortable environment for patients, resident, visitors and staff while supporting and guiding the Environmental Services team.

The Working Lead must maintain the highest level of confidentiality and be respectful and compassionate in all interactions. The Working Lead participates in the training/orientation of new staff. These tasks are to be completed with mínimal supervision, in a busy and fast paced environment.

Required Qualifications:

Completion of Grade 12 or equivalent. Physically capable to walk and/or stand for the duration of your shift, and perform repetitive physical movements.


Additional Required Qualifications:

Ability to read, write, speak and understand English.

Requires moderate to heavy physical exertion of which may include repetitive and/or long periods of standing, walking, bending, crouching, stooping, stretching, reaching, grasping, pushing, pulling, or lifting.

Required to wear PPE (Personal Protective Equipment) for long periods of time. (i.


e:
Face Mask, Eye Protection, Gloves, Gowns, etc.).


Preferred Qualifications:

Able to work holidays/weekends and a variety of shift times. Basic computer skills. Previous cleaning experience. Ability to clean in isolation areas (ED, OR, ICU, NICU, etc.). WHMIS certificate. Previous leadership experience.
